Added support for wildcard iterations in JFlat, allowing users to iterate over all children of an object regardless of their keys. This enhancement simplifies the process of flattening JSON structures with dynamic or unknown keys.

Wildcard expansion currently iterates over the full map.keySet() for each existingEntry. Since map is a TreeMap, this can become expensive on large inputs (and on entry keys that already expanded from arrays). Consider iterating only the relevant key range (e.g., starting from the prefix via tailMap(prefix, false) and stopping once keys no longer match the prefix) to keep the wildcard lookup closer to O(matches) instead of O(totalKeys).

childPath.toLowerCase() uses the default JVM locale, which can lead to incorrect case folding (and therefore incorrect dedup) in some locales (e.g., Turkish). Use locale-independent folding (e.g., toLowerCase(Locale.ROOT)) or a case-insensitive Set implementation to avoid locale-sensitive behavior.

The "\\*" path element is now reserved to mean “literal * key”. This makes it impossible to target a JSON property whose name is literally "\\*" (backslash + asterisk), because it will always be interpreted as an escape sequence. If supporting such keys matters, consider defining an escape for the backslash itself (e.g., "\\\\*" in the path syntax) and handling it before the wildcard escape logic.

The existing non-wildcard array traversal path (/arrayB/id) is no longer covered by tests after switching this assertion to /arrayB/*/id. Since wildcard support is additive, keeping an assertion for /arrayB/id (in addition to the new wildcard one) would help catch regressions and confirm backward compatibility.
